I had to try this recipe, as it sounded so....well...wierd! I am glad I did. It was very different and exotic tasting. I crushed the cornflakes but will crush them even finer next time as they were a little too pronounced after baking, and I will do less bananas as the recipe didn't need that much to get the full banana taste. I also substituted coconut milk instead of the regular milk. I served mine with sliced kiwi and pineapple tidbits, and the Asian Coconut Rice from this site (which works out perfectly to use up the remainder of the can of coconut milk). Thank you for this outrageously different recipe!

We really enjoyed this unusual dish. The only problem was that the measurements were really off. For 2 people I changed the measurements to 2 tsp lemon juice, 1/8 can sweetened condensed milk, 1 1/4 tbsp of coconut, 1/8 tsp cardamom, 1 banana, 1/2 cup crushed cornflakes, 2 chicken breasts, and 2 1/2 tbsp melted butter. Tasted a lot like eating a dessert for dinner so it may not be for everyone but we loved it.

This recipe was AWESOME!!!!! I think the recipe needed 6 chicken breasts, not 6lbs-that doesn't even make sense as there wouldn't even be enough dip for everything. Anyway I used 4 extrememly thick boneless chicken breasts and the cooking time was perfect. I also put the bananas in a cookie sheet (not a 9x13 pan) and they came out perfect as well. If your bananas are mushy, they were too ripe-use extremely green bananas. Definitely one of the tastiest dishes I've made.

This was a great recipe, I changed it a bit, by placing 1 cup of shredded coconut in the food processor and chopping to a fine grind and adding that to the breading crumbs. I also deep fried the bananas, but the chicken was much better and moist when baked. I was really surprised that everyone loved them, especially the banana!
